Expanded network
16 July 2018
ABB has extended the reach of its UK variable speed drives (VSD) and mechanical power transmission products with an expansion of the ABB authorised value provider network.

EDC (North East) is appointed as an ABB authorised value provider serving customers in Tyne & Wear and Cumbria with VSDs up to 500 kW and a range of life cycle services.
The company operates from a dedicated facility in Gateshead. The services include reliability assessments and harmonic surveys, through to installation and start-up, operation and maintenance, upgrade and retrofit and replacement and recycling.
Beta Power Engineering based in Stockport, Cheshire is expanding its current role as an ABB authorised value provider for low voltage motors, with the addition of VSDs up to 500 kW.
West Midlands-based Race Transmissions is appointed the first national ABB authorised value provider for mechanical power transmission products.
